Peach liquor carrots

Carrots can be made in many different ways! I prefer them slowly baked in a cast iron pan! Some smokey touches from a firewood and a range of quality spices makes it even better! These peach liquor carrots are a sidedish feast! Perfect with a piece of red meat or chicken.

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Total Time 50 minutes
Servings 2

Ingredients

  • 500 gr. Carrots
  • 1 tbsp Olive oil
  • 1/2 tsp Cumin powder
  • 1/2 tsp Ginger powder
  • 1/2 tsp Curry powder
  • Salt and Pepper at taste
  • 1/3 cup Peach Liquor
  • Parsley at taste

Instructions

  • Add some olive oil to a cast iron pan and toss in the spices. Let simmer for a couple of minutes so their flavor can develop well! 
  • Remove the peel of the carrots and quarter them endlong. 
  • Add the carrots to the skillet (cast iron pan) and let simmer for about 10 min.
  • Add the peach liquor to the skillet and put back in the BBQ for a half hour at 150°C on a direct heat source. Stir halfway to prevent the carrots from  burning and get a nice caramellisation on more carrots. 
  • Test for doneness and taste. Add some more spices when desired and finish with salt, pepper and parsley.
